Students have the option to study additional languages alongside their required courses. At present the Language Centre offers courses in the following fourteen modern foreign languages:
Each course description contains information about the content of the course, time and room, the respective instructor, course materials and potential prerequisites. Furthermore, students can register directly through the Student Information System (SIS). A minimum of 12 participants is required for a course to take place. Students who require an English version of a specific course description are asked to contact the Language Centre ().
The courses are classified according to the different levels of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Students who wish to attend a language course on A1 level (i.e. a course for beginners) are expected to possess a reasonable level of German in order to follow the course (e.g. instructions, grammar explanations etc.).
If you would like to take a language course currently not offered by the Language Centre (e.g. in another language or with a focus on a specific subject), we can organize such a course for you - provided that at least 12 participants would like to attend this class. As soon as you have found the required number of interested persons, please contact us with your suggestion.
The courses are free of charge for students enrolled at the Bonn-Rhein-Sieg University.
